Ryzen 5 5600x overclocking

On an x570 mobo about how high could you overclock a ryzen 5600x with it still being stable. I plan to do a dedicated loop to cool the cpu if that matters for more reasonable overclocks.

Best way to overclock is tweaking pbo. I would first undervolt as far as possible with the curve optimizer. From there I would try raising the max pbo boost value to 200-250 ish.

 

Now if you want to get more advanced to that you can tweak the above and run a lower curve offset like -5 in your first and second best cores.

 

This allows your all core and single core speeds to perform much better.

 

My 5900x can see core boosts up to and sometimes slightly over 5.2.ghz on my best 4 cores ( 1st and 2nd on two ccxs) and the rest of my cores all break 5ghz from time to time. Now where things get interesting is my all core which will run at 4.8ghz. The problem I have is after about 5 minutes that drops down to high 4.6 - low 4.7ghz despite good temps. So it is more than likely a time threshold on pbo I haven't found yet.

 

Anyways my point is these overclock much differently than previous chips have.

3 hours ago, kucharczykt said:

Is there something wrong with ballistics ram? I was going to use them anyways just at lower capasities and slower speeds becuase there are white non rgb variants.

Nothing wrong, they're just not the fastest since it's always some variant of Micron Rev.E in them (above 3000MHz that is). Best is ofc Samsung B-die, but even on the cheap Hynix DJR and CJR are arguably better (since Ryzen cares about latency, not max memory frequency).

On 2/8/2021 at 12:30 PM, kucharczykt said:

On an x570 mobo about how high could you overclock a ryzen 5600x with it still being stable. I plan to do a dedicated loop to cool the cpu if that matters for more reasonable overclocks.

I had three different 5600x's that all were able to do 4.85 all cores, at 1.3-1.4v. On a cheap b550 itx board.
